To start the process, go to analysis >> create elevation grid from 3d vector lidar data. the grid creation options window will open up. select the contour layer and the vertical unit. we can choose the automatic grid spacing or specify it manually. in this example, i choose the manual grid spacing. you can also check other options if you need them. The 3d vector data to elevation grid analytic aims to transform a vector file that has been uploaded to the aether into a digital surface model (dsm). you will then be able to explore it as a common dsm, for example, to compare it with other data produced or imported into the platform. The stereo image pairs of an image collection are used to generate a point cloud (3d points) from which elevation data can be derived. the derived elevation data will be used to orthorectify the image collection in the ortho mapping workspace.

The elevation profile panel is a plotting tool for side view, for visualizing elevation data along a line. it supports vector, raster, mesh and point cloud layers. Each pixel in the terrain raster represents the average elevation in meters at that location. the dark pixels represent areas with low altitude and lighter pixels represent areas with high altitude.
